Powercom Speed Zone Forced To Cancel Tuesday Program
OSHKOSH, WI – Flooding weekend rains coupled with little drying time left
the Powercom Speed Zone under water and forced the cancellation of Tuesday
night’s racing program.
The track will be back in action on Tuesday night, June 1st with a full
program highlighted by the Budweiser Modifieds, American Auto Sales Street
Stocks, Miller Lite Grand National Stock Cars, and the Signmakers/Corporate
Impressions Dirt Devils. The first green flag will fall at 7:00 pm.
The track will then race on June 8th and June 15th before taking the week off
on June 22nd. Due to other activities taking place at the Sunnyview Expo
Center that week racing action that night has been shifted to The Raceway at
Powercom Park in Beaver Dam as Prestige Custom Cabinetry presents a modified
special featuring Tony Stewart and Kasey Kahne.
The Interstate Racing Association sprint cars will return to the Powercom
Speed Zone on Tuesday night, June 29th for their only 2004 appearance in
Oshkosh. The show will round out the month and include the street stock
and dirt devil divisions.
